This policy‑oriented report explains Chinese‑nexus cyber tradecraft as a long‑term extension of state strategy, doctrine, and geopolitical objectives. It analyzes historical tradecraft phases, operator decision models, strategic trends, Western defense shortcomings, and long‑term shifts in identity‑centric access. The report frames cyber operations as strategic leverage rather than isolated campaigns, offering guidance for reshaping Western policy and security models.
